Top 5 Pirate Games on iOS in Europe Q3 2023

During the third quarter of 2023, the top 5 pirate-themed games on iOS in Europe showcased varying performance trends in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at how each game fared.

Voyage: The Grand Fleet from MGCFUTURES LTD experienced notable fluctuations in its weekly revenue. Starting at around $13.6K in early July, the game saw a peak of approximately $171K by the end of the month before stabilizing between $71.8K and $125.9K through September. Downloads surged dramatically mid-quarter, reaching an impressive 170K in early September, up from around 8.2K in early July. Weekly active users followed a similar trend, peaking at 326K in early September before declining to 164K by the end of the quarter.

Pirate Treasures - Gems Puzzle by TAPCLAP maintained a relatively stable performance throughout the quarter. Weekly revenue fluctuated modestly, with a low of $4K and a high of $6.8K. Downloads remained steady, averaging around 4.7K to 6.1K per week. Active users showed consistency, hovering between 53.3K and 56.3K during the quarter.

Save The Pirate! Help! Escape! from Volodymyr Bondarenko experienced a decline in both downloads and active users. Weekly downloads dropped from 5.7K at the end of June to just 471 by the end of September. Active users also saw a downward trend, decreasing from 26.2K in late June to 17.4K by the end of Q3. Revenue remained minimal, staying under $31 throughout the period.

Pirate Raid: Caribbean Battle by SayGames LTD saw a decline in weekly revenue, from $4.2K at the end of June to approximately $1.5K by the end of September. Downloads showed a similar downward trend, starting at 4.4K and dropping to just 260 by the end of the quarter. Active users decreased from 6.9K in late June to 1.6K by the end of September.

Pirates of the Caribbean : ToW by JOYCITY Corp showcased relatively stable revenue, averaging around $16.7K to $25.9K throughout the quarter. Downloads remained low but consistent, ranging from 447 to 842 per week. Active users also showed stability, staying between 1.1K and 1.4K during the period.
